Algorithm for designing a hydraulic scissor lifting platform

Abstract: The paper describes the hydraulic scissor platforms and presents an algorithm for their design and optimization. Depending on the dimensions of the platform, the maximum height at which it rises and the maximum load is presented a program for calculating the number of scissors and the forces in the joints. The obtained data allow to choose the type of hydraulic table (with one, two or three scissors) and sizing the elements according to the beneficiary's requirements.

“…The height of the electrical equipment in the substation is usually 1 to 2 m. Considering that the examined electrical equipment is distributed in the different locations in the substation, the vertical lifting mechanism needs to provide a dynamic movement to the desired inspection position. Generally, the scissor-type mechanism is often used to produce the vertical lifting component, as shown in Figure 12(a) (Ciupan et al , 2019), where the lifting motion is accomplished by two hydraulic cylinders mounted between the scissors. However, the large volume and low accuracy cause the inextricable difficulty in the realistic applications.…”

“…To increase the stability of the lifting platform, Cornel et al added a hydraulic damping system to the bottom of the scissor structure to counteract the vibrations above the platform. At the same time, the hydraulics could give additional support to the lifting platform to meet the greater force requirements [3]. However, hydraulic struts are expensive and have a higher failure rate than traditional mechanical structures.…”
